The interest in finding reliable and highly sensitive sensors for
water quality control has grown recently empowered by the explosion
of cutting-edge technologies such as nanotechnologies,
optoelectronics, and computing on one hand and by the increasing
need for more secure control of water quality on the other hand.
This book highlights a number of modern topics in the field of
biosensing particularly for water sensing in which the signal is
enhanced, starting from surface enhanced spectroscopies using
plasmonic structures such as Raman scattering (SERS), infrared
enhanced absorption (SEIRA), and surface enhanced fluorescence
(SEF). The SPR enhanced detection is highlighted in two chapters
and addressed using signal processing and the use of color of
solutions as a result of modification of the LSPR properties of
nanoparticles. Porous materials are another field of research where
the enhancement is achieved due to the increasing the area-
to-volume ratio. Good examples are the two emerging fields of
porous Si and sculptured thin films prepared by the oblique
deposition technique. One of the long standing problems is bacteria
detection in water which is addressed thoroughly with emphasis on
the problems usually encountered in detecting large bioentities.
